**Action item 4: Gate Bannerlane rollouts behind a staged flag**

So, the consent banner went to 100% of Quillet traffic in one shot and the French locale strings weren't even merged yet — not great. Going forward, all Bannerlane changes ship behind the staged rollout flag with a mandatory 24h soak at 5%. Reviewer: please block any PR touching consent copy that skips the locale checklist. I wrote up the new flag procedure and the checklist on the rollout page below.

wiki page, tahaf-tajog: https://jira.ordindyn.corp/pipeline

Plowline Gateway — environments. Plowline ingests telemetry from field equipment via three environments: bench (simulated tractors), pilot (one test farm), and fleet (production). Reviewers should note that message schemas are versioned per environment, and the pilot broker accepts unsigned payloads while fleet does not. The fleet ingest service boots with the configuration values shown below.

settings of tagef-bawif:
DRUIX_HOST=druix.zemvarlabs.internal
DRUIX_PORT=8000

Payroll export changed from fixed-width to delimited in Ledgerhut 4.2. Every export now carries provenance metadata: builder identity, source revision, and pipeline stage. Contractors: do not hand-edit exports; downstream validation at Corvane Payroll rejects anything lacking a signed provenance record. If you need to verify an artifact, compare its manifest against the registry entry, not the filename. Exports older than 4.2 are grandfathered until Q3. The canonical build that introduced the new format is recorded below.

trace token, bagag-fahag: htk21_1a5003b533f7b0cca4331

Key Ceremony Checklist — Item 7 (Varnholt Systems)

[ ] Confirm stale-cache postmortem (incident VX-31) remediations are merged before signing. The bug: edge nodes in the Keldermoor region served expired trust bundles for 40 minutes after rotation. Fix: TTL hard cap plus rotation-triggered purge. Reviewer must verify purge hook fires in staging logs. No signing proceeds until the security reviewer initials this item. Once verified, unseal the ceremony envelope and read aloud the recovery passphrase printed below.

unlock words, yadup-yagef: zorael-druix